Blender is a free, open-source, and community project used by artists to create 3D models. With this animation software, creators can work on modeling, rigging, rendering, simulation, visual effects, and motion tracking. Blender’s API for Python offers the possibility for additional code customization and tools. Blender is suitable for beginning artists, experienced professionals, and small agencies and is efficient on different platforms like Linux, Windows, and Mac OS.

This platform also has a user-friendly interface and a community offering support for its users through tutorials and threads. The functions that Blender provides are the following: Bezier & NURBS Curves (2D), NURBS Surfaces (3D), meshes, sculpting, data import and export, and many more. Users can also integrate add-ons for better efficiency and workflow. Blender is used by major companies like Sony and Epic Games for their tools and features.

ICT in the United Kingdom: General Profile and Insights

The UK technology sector is growing more than two-and-a-half times faster than the overall economy and London has been ranked as the second most connected place for tech in the world behind Silicon Valley in the US. 

According to the Tech Nation Report 2018, the UK digital tech sector is worth nearly £184bn to the economy, a rise from £170bn in 2016. The turnover of digital technology companies grew by 4.5% between 2016 and 2017, compared with 1.7% growth in UK GDP.

Why you should work with a UK-based company?

Probably the second largest IT hub in the world, the UK is one of the fastest-growing IT leaders. It is the home of over 225,000 IT & web companies based on a report delivered by Computer Weekly. Web companies from the UK provide the entire range of services and are known for good management, rich business culture, and great tech performance

What you should be aware of when working with UK web companies

A report by Tech Nation in 2018 revealed the main challenges companies and IT hubs face, is related to access to talent, affecting 83% of tech hubs. Access to funding and poor transport links were also found to be major challenges for some of the UK’s tech hubs.

How the UK IT industry relates to the neighboring countries

Having a leading IT infrastructure, the IT industry in the UK increased its potential and following the global trends, just like the US, it will focus more on certifying and developing already existing professionals rather than hiring new skills.  

On the background of a fast-developing EU market, the UK looks weaker alone than in the community. Brexit has forced tech giants and many IT companies to leave for other EU countries, especially Ireland and Germany - a report from Tech Spot reveals.

How to select the right Blender platform?

Finding a good platform providing Blender services for your project is very important. You should take into consideration some things to make the right selection. Start by finding out what your project’s type and specifications are. The remaining criteria to look into are:

  1. Do online research: Study a platform that has a steady presence online. Check their web pages and social channels to get to know them better. 
  2. Study portfolios: Look through portfolios to analyze their work style, creativity, done projects, and scalability. Choose the platform that fits these features.
  3. Experience and skills: Look for agencies that have experience in using Blender, because they can better understand the platform’s details and required abilities. You can also look for a Blender agency that has experience in your industry for improved communication, progress, and efficiency.
  4. Trial time: Some platforms can offer you a trial for your project. During this time, you can observe the candidates' professionalism and whether they follow the project’s requirements.
  5. Legal considerations: Review the needed law requirements to avoid any issues in the future, and to create the working contracts, agreements.
